Chromakey Muslin Backdrops: Mastering Green Screen Effects
Achieving professional green screen visuals with a chromakey fabric is relatively straightforward, but necessitates a certain key approaches . These flexible backdrops, generally made from durable muslin, offer a even surface for precise keying in film creation software. Adequate lighting is absolutely important; eliminating shadows and ensuring even illumination across the complete backdrop will dramatically improve the final product’s appearance . Furthermore, distance between the subject and the green is essential to avoid green spills and achieve a authentic portrayal.

Keying Backdrops: Techniques and Hacks for Seamless Blending
Achieving a believable green screen effect requires past simply placing a green backdrop. Ensure even exposure across your background; uneven light creates difficult-to-remove shadows and highlights. Set your subject at a distance of at least 6 meters from the backdrop to minimize spill. Additionally, dress your talent in clothing colors that stand out from the background – avoid variants of green! Finally, evaluate using a professional keyer software and fine-tune your settings for a genuinely polished result.
